Key Components of the Net Worth Statement
A strong net worth statement lists assets such as cash, investments, real estate, and equipment, minus allowable liabilities. The Florida self insurance net worth form requires detailed breakdowns so reviewers can verify each category. Consistency, supporting documents, and current valuations increase trust and reduce follow up questions.

Applicants often confuse net worth with annual revenue, but the two measure different things. Net worth reflects what you own after debts, while revenue shows incoming cash flow. Understanding this difference helps you present a compliant picture and avoid misinterpretations during review.
How to Calculate Florida Self Imsurance Requirements
Start by reviewing the specific minimum net worth thresholds set for your industry or license type. Gather recent balance sheets, appraisal reports, and bank statements to support asset values. Subtract outstanding debts, liens, and obligations to arrive at your true net position.
